| 疫苗类型 | 疫苗名称 | 目标人群 | 研发公司 | 临床试验阶段 | 临床试验号 |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 减毒活疫苗 | LID∆M2-2/1030s | 婴幼儿 | NIAID (Medi) | Ⅰ期 | NCT02794870 |
| RSV ΔNS2 Δ1313 I1314L | 婴幼儿 | NIAID (Medi) | Ⅰ/Ⅱ期 | NCT01893554 | |
| RSV 6120/Δ NS2/1030s | 婴幼儿 | NIAID (Sanofi) | Ⅰ期 | NCT03387137 | |
| RSV 6120/ΔNS1 | 婴幼儿 | NIAID (Sanofi) | Ⅰ期 | NCT03596801 | |
| MV-012-968 | 婴幼儿 | Meissa Vaccines | Ⅰ期 | NCT04909021 | |
| CodaVax-RSV | 老年人 | Codagenix, Inc | Ⅰ期 | NCT04295070 | |
| 蛋白/亚单位疫苗 | BARS13 | 老年人 | Advaccine (Suzhou) | Ⅱ期 | NCT04681833 |
| RSV F DS-Cav1 | 成年人 | NIAID | Ⅰ期 | NCT03049488 | |
| VN-0200 | 老年人 | Daiichi Sankyo Co., Ltd. | Ⅱ期 | NCT05547087 | |
| IVX-A12 (RSV/hMPV) | 老年人 | Icosavax | Ⅱ期 | NCT05903183 | |
| IVX-121 (RSV) | 老年人 | Icosavax | Ⅰ期 | 2020-003633-38 | |
| mRNA疫苗 | mRNA-1345 | 婴幼儿 | Moderna | Ⅰ期 | NCT04528719 |
| mRNA LNP | 老年人 | Sanofi | Ⅰ期 | NCT05639894 |
Table 1 The hRSV vaccines in clinical development
